Dimensions and constraints

Numbers without context are guesses. Pin them down up front.

Mind printability

Mind printability

Walls should be at least 1.2 mm, or they crack. Short bridges print cleanly; past about 10 mm they start to sag. Surfaces leaning up to 45° from vertical print without supports.

Cite standards

Cite standards

"M5 cap screw", "M5 countersunk", "608 bearing". The standard name already carries every dimension, so you don't have to spell them out.

Constrain the envelope

Constrain the envelope

"Fits a 256 × 256 mm bed." A stated build plate stops the model from drifting to absurd sizes.
